Besiktas Snatches a Draw
In a nail-biting finish, Besiktas managed to salvage a point against Kasimpasa on Monday. With their sights set on European competition, Solskjaer’s team scored a penalty in the 90th minute, courtesy of Gedson, to level the game at 1-1.
The Istanbul club faced a setback when they lost a central player to injury just 17 minutes in, with Kasimpasa already leading 1-0. Things took a turn for the worse when Sanuç, the replacement for Topçu, got expelled before halftime, leaving his team in a precarious position.
Despite the challenges, Besiktas found a way to bounce back. With Rafa and João Mário in the starting lineup, Gedson became the third Portuguese player to make a crucial impact. Stepping up to take the penalty, Gedson didn’t flinch and secured a point that keeps Besiktas in fourth place – the last spot that guarantees a European competition berth.
